Biological Background: MBNL1 Function and Localization

  • Muscleblind-like protein 1 (MBNL1), also known as Triplet-expansion RNA-binding protein, is an RNA-binding protein that regulates alternative splicing of pre-mRNAs.
  • MBNL1 can act as either an activator or repressor of splicing depending on the target; for example, it inhibits inclusion of cardiac troponin-T (TNNT2) exon 5 while promoting inclusion of the insulin receptor (IR) exon in muscle.
  • It antagonizes the splicing activity of CELF proteins and competes with U2AF2 to regulate TNNT2 exon 5 skipping.
  • MBNL1 binds to a consensus RNA sequence 5′-YGCU(U/G)Y-3′ and recognizes stem-loop structures, such as those in TNNT2 intron 4 and expanded CUG repeats.
  • In vascular smooth muscle cells, MBNL1 cooperates with RBPMS and RBFOX2 to modulate alternative splicing. Related references: PMID:37548402
  • Subcellularly, MBNL1 localizes to the nucleus, cytoplasm, and cytoplasmic granules.
  • It is highly expressed in cardiac and skeletal muscle, with weaker expression in brain, placenta, lung, liver, kidney, and pancreas.
  • The protein contains zinc finger domains, is subject to phosphorylation, and has been implicated in corneal dystrophy.

Experimental Guidance and Technical Tips

  • The antibody is raised against a synthetic peptide spanning amino acids 280–380 of human MBNL1 (NP_997176.1). For Western blotting, consider using lysates from human, mouse, or rat muscle tissues, where MBNL1 is highly expressed.
  • When setting up ELISA, titrate the antibody against the immunogen peptide as a positive control and validate against cell or tissue lysates to assess specificity.
  • Owing to polyclonal nature, the antibody may recognize multiple epitopes; confirm specificity via knockdown or overexpression experiments in the relevant model system.
  • Cross-reactivity with mouse and rat is reported; however, validate band patterns and signal intensity in each species independently.
